Lead Software Engineer - Identity Platform

A technology company operating a SuperApp ecosystem with ride-hailing, payments, and logistics services.
Backend
Staff Software Engineer
Hybrid
5,000+ Employees
7+ years of experience
Enterprise SaaS · Finance

Description For Lead Software Engineer - Identity Platform

GoTo Group is seeking a Lead Software Engineer to join their Identity Platform team, a crucial component of their SuperApp ecosystem. This role sits at the intersection of security and user experience, focusing on login, verification, and account safety for millions of users across the GoTo ecosystem.

The team is currently undertaking an exciting initiative to platformize their solutions across the entire GoTo ecosystem, ensuring all of Gojek's apps benefit from the same world-class experience. As the Lead Software Engineer, you'll be responsible for designing and implementing secure authentication systems while maintaining a frictionless user experience.

The position requires a strong technical background with at least 7 years of experience in backend development using languages like Go-Lang, Java, or Ruby. You'll lead a team of engineers, making this an excellent opportunity for those looking to combine technical expertise with leadership responsibilities.

Working in a dynamic team of tech enthusiasts and gamers, you'll face challenges that directly impact security and usability across the platform. The role offers the opportunity to work on cutting-edge projects that protect millions of users while enhancing their experience across the GoTo ecosystem.

This hybrid position, based in either Bengaluru or Gurugram, offers the chance to work with a global team and make a significant impact on one of the world's fastest-growing mobile applications in ride-hailing, payments, and logistics. If you're passionate about building secure, scalable systems and leading teams to success, this role presents an exciting opportunity to shape the future of digital identity management.

Last updated 3 days ago

Responsibilities For Lead Software Engineer - Identity Platform

  • Design, build and improve login & verification experiences for mobile apps
  • Partner with product management and cross-functional teams to define feature roadmap
  • Build robust API contracts with backend engineering teams
  • Manage stakeholder communications regarding deliverables, risks, and dependencies
  • Perform code reviews following engineering handbook standards
  • Mentor junior engineers, designers and QAs
  • Review tracking and reporting system metrics for the team

Requirements For Lead Software Engineer - Identity Platform

Go
Java
Ruby
Kubernetes
  • 7+ years of hands-on experience in designing, developing, testing and deploying applications
  • 1 year of experience in leading a team of engineers
  • Proficiency in OOP, SQL, Design Patterns, and Data modeling
  • Experience with K8s deployment
  • Knowledge of Agile methodologies, TDD, Test Engineering, and CI/CD
  • Ability to write ADRs, RFCs, and handle planning phase
  • Experience in scoping and refining user stories
  • Ability to write model code for functional and non-functional requirements

Interested in this job?

Jobs Related To GoTo Group Lead Software Engineer - Identity Platform

Lead Software Engineer - Cartography

Lead Software Engineer position at GoTo Group focusing on cartography and routing systems for Southeast Asia's largest digital ecosystem.

Staff Software Engineer

Staff Software Engineer role at PermitFlow, building full-stack solutions to streamline construction permitting processes using React, TypeScript, and Node.js.

Staff Product Engineer

Staff Product Engineer position at Axle, building universal API for insurance data access. Node.js, TypeScript, distributed systems expertise required.

Network Architect, Software, Google Public Sector

Network Architect position at Google Public Sector focusing on software development for networking solutions, requiring expertise in Linux networking stack and infrastructure orchestration.

Senior Solutions Acceleration Architect, Application

Senior Solutions Acceleration Architect position at Google Cloud, focusing on cloud-native application architecture and full-stack development in Singapore.